Hey小伙伴们,今天要分享的是如何在IIS中配置PHP,让你们的Web开发之路更加顺畅,IIS(Internet Information Services)是微软提供的Web服务器软件,而PHP则是Web开发中常用的脚本语言,将两者结合起来,就能搭建一个强大的Web开发环境,让我们一步步来搞定这个配置过程吧!
确保你的Windows系统中已经安装了IIS,如果没有,可以通过“控制面板”中的“程序和功能”->“启用或关闭Windows功能”来添加IIS,选择安装IIS后,记得勾选“Web服务器”和“CGI”模块,因为我们需要这些功能来运行PHP。
我们需要安装PHP,你可以从PHP官方网站下载最新的PHP版本,下载完成后,解压到一个你记得住的路径,比如C:php,这一步很关键,因为之后我们需要在这个路径下找到PHP的可执行文件。
安装好PHP后,我们需要告诉IIS使用PHP来处理PHP文件,打开IIS管理器,找到你的网站,右键点击选择“添加处理程序映射”,在弹出的窗口中,填写如下信息:
- 请求路径:*.php
- 模块名:CgiModule
- 可执行文件:C:phpphp-cgi.exe(确保这个路径是你的PHP安装路径下的php-cgi.exe文件)
点击“确定”保存设置,这样,IIS就知道如何处理以.php为后缀的文件了。
我们还需要做一些额外的配置,以确保PHP能够正常工作,打开你的PHP安装目录下的php.ini文件,找到cgi.fix_pathinfo这一项,将其值设置为0,这样可以避免PHP在处理文件时出现路径错误的问题。
保存php.ini文件后,我们需要重启IIS服务,在“运行”窗口(Win+R)输入iisreset,然后回车,这样IIS服务就会重启,并且应用新的配置。
我们需要测试一下配置是否成功,在IIS网站的根目录下创建一个名为info.php的新文件,内容如下:
<?php phpinfo(); ?>
在浏览器中访问info.php文件,如果能看到PHP的信息页面,那么恭喜你,配置成功了!
别忘了配置好PHP的扩展,在php.ini文件中,找到extension相关的行,去掉前面的分号(;),以启用相应的扩展,如果你需要使用MySQL,就找到extension=mysqli这一行,去掉前面的分号。
好了,到这里,你应该已经成功在IIS中配置了PHP,你可以开始你的Web开发之旅了,记得在开发过程中,多尝试,多实践,这样才能更快地PHP和IIS的配置技巧,如果遇到问题,不要怕,多查资料,多尝试不同的解决方案,总会有办法解决的,加油,Web开发的大门已经向你敞开!



还没有评论,来说两句吧...